Understanding Hemp Oil and Its Benefits for Dogs

Hemp oil, also known as hemp seed oil, is derived from the seeds of the hemp plant. It is a rich source of essential fatty acids, including omega-3 and omega-6, which are known to support overall health in dogs. These fatty acids play a crucial role in promoting a healthy coat, reducing inflammation, supporting joint health, and boosting the immune system. Hemp oil is also packed with vitamins and minerals, such as vitamin E, phosphorus, potassium, and magnesium, which contribute to the overall well-being of dogs.

Exploring CBD Oil and Its Potential Benefits for Dogs

CBD oil, short for cannabidiol oil, is derived from the flowers, leaves, and stalks of the hemp plant. Unlike hemp oil, which is extracted solely from the seeds, CBD oil contains high levels of cannabidiol, a non-psychoactive compound known for its potential therapeutic effects. CBD oil has been studied for its potential benefits in managing pain, reducing anxiety, improving sleep, and supporting overall well-being in dogs. It interacts with the endocannabinoid system, a complex system of receptors and neurotransmitters within the body, to promote balance and homeostasis.

Key Differences between Hemp Oil and CBD Oil for Dogs

One of the key differences between hemp oil and CBD oil for dogs lies in their cannabinoid content. While hemp oil contains only trace amounts of cannabinoids, CBD oil is specifically formulated to contain higher concentrations of cannabidiol. Another difference lies in their potential benefits, as CBD oil is often sought after for its potential therapeutic effects, while hemp oil is primarily used as a nutritional supplement. It is essential to understand these differences before choosing a product for your dog’s specific needs.

Composition: Hemp Oil vs CBD Oil for Dogs

Hemp oil is primarily composed of omega fatty acids, vitamins, and minerals, making it a valuable nutritional supplement for dogs. On the other hand, CBD oil contains cannabidiol as the primary active ingredient, along with other cannabinoids, terpenes, and flavonoids. These additional compounds work synergistically with CBD to enhance its potential effects. The composition of CBD oil may vary depending on the extraction method and the specific strain of hemp used.

The Extraction Process: Hemp Oil vs CBD Oil for Dogs

The extraction process for hemp oil involves cold-pressing the seeds of the hemp plant, similar to how olive oil is extracted. This method ensures that the oil retains its nutritional value and does not contain any cannabinoids. CBD oil, on the other hand, is typically extracted using more advanced methods, such as CO2 extraction or solvent extraction. These techniques allow for the extraction of cannabinoids, including cannabidiol, from the plant material, resulting in a concentrated oil.

Legality: Hemp Oil vs CBD Oil for Dogs

The legality of hemp oil and CBD oil for dogs can vary depending on the jurisdiction. In many countries, hemp oil derived from industrial hemp is legal, as it contains negligible amounts of THC, the psychoactive compound found in cannabis. However, CBD oil extracted from the hemp plant may be subject to stricter regulations due to its higher cannabinoid content. It is important to research and understand the local laws and regulations regarding hemp and CBD products for pets before purchasing or using them.

Potential Uses and Applications of Hemp Oil for Dogs

Due to its nutritional profile, hemp oil can be used as a dietary supplement for dogs of all ages and breeds. It can support a healthy coat and skin, improve joint health, boost the immune system, and enhance overall well-being. Additionally, hemp oil may help with digestive issues, promote cardiovascular health, and provide relief from allergies and inflammation. However, it is important to consult with a veterinarian before introducing any new supplements into your dog’s diet.

Potential Uses and Applications of CBD Oil for Dogs

CBD oil has gained recognition for its potential therapeutic effects in dogs. It can be used to manage pain and inflammation associated with conditions such as arthritis or injuries. CBD oil may also help reduce anxiety, stress, and separation anxiety in dogs, promoting a sense of calmness. Some pet owners have reported improved sleep patterns, reduced seizures in epileptic dogs, and improved overall mobility in senior dogs. However, it is crucial to consult with a veterinarian to determine the appropriate dosage for your dog’s specific condition.

Safety Considerations: Hemp Oil vs CBD Oil for Dogs

Hemp oil and CBD oil are generally considered safe for dogs when used appropriately. However, it is essential to choose high-quality products that have been tested for purity and potency. Additionally, it is important to start with a low dosage and gradually increase it to assess your dog’s response and tolerance. It is also worth noting that CBD oil may interact with certain medications, so it is crucial to inform your veterinarian if your dog is currently on any medication.
